aws_resource_search? Documentación completa aquí
La búsqueda de recursos de AWS (ARS) es una aplicación terminal que permite búsquedas interactivas de recursos de AWS. Es una consola Mini AWS en su entorno terminal o de caparazón.
Utiliza técnicas de indexación avanzadas que admiten full-text search (cualquier palabra, ya no restringido a la coincidencia de prefijo o sufijo), fuzzy search (tolerar errores de ortografía) y búsqueda n-gram (permitiendo la coincidencia de la serie de n personajes adyacentes).
ARS viene con almacenamiento en caché de consultas incorporado, asegurando blazing-fast performance incluso cuando se trata de una gran cantidad de recursos de AWS, como roles IAM, funciones Lambda, pilas de formación de nubes y más.
Como biblioteca de Python, la instalación es tan simple como ejecutar pip install aws_resource_search . No es necesario configurar bases de datos, herramientas de búsqueda adicionales o instalar ningún otro software.
Los datos permanecen en su computadora portátil, no hay un servidor remoto involucrado.
La edición comunitaria de código abierto de ARS permite la búsqueda dentro de una sola cuenta de AWS y una región de AWS a la vez. Puede cambiar entre diferentes cuentas de AWS antes de realizar sus búsquedas. Por otro lado, la edición Enterprise de ARS ofrece la capacidad de buscar en múltiples cuentas de AWS y regiones de AWS, proporcionando una visión agregada. Actualmente, la versión empresarial está en beta y se espera que esté generalmente disponible a principios de 2024 ".
Buscar cubo S3.
Busque la ejecución de la función de paso, que es un recurso infantil de la máquina de estado de la función de paso.
aws_resource_search se lanza en Pypi, por lo que todo lo que necesita es:
$ pip install aws_resource_searchPara actualizar a la última versión:
$ pip install --upgrade aws_resource_search